怎么样在vc、delphi里面运用mysql(mysql odbc驱动地运用)

慕名而来life

慕名而来life

2016-02-19 20:31

生活已是百般艰难,为何不努力一点。下面图老师就给大家分享怎么样在vc、delphi里面运用mysql(mysql odbc驱动地运用),希望可以让热爱学习的朋友们体会到设计的小小的乐趣。

  怎样在vc、delphi、vb等程序中使用mysql呢(mysql odbc驱动程序的使用) 我们经常会遇到这样问题,怎样在非web程序或ASP程序中使用mysql数据库呢?对于这个问题有两个解决方案: 

  1.使用mysql提供的api函数库。

  很多有名的mysql客户端工具就是这样实现的,大名鼎鼎的winmysql工具就是这样的。这在大部分的开发工具中都可以实现。

  比如vc,bcb,delphi,vb等,只要能调用第三方的api就能实现。但对程序员的要求很高,而且要熟悉一套mysql的api函数集,这不是对每个人都很轻松的事。而且这种方法不能用于ASP等程序,因为它不支持com对象。

  2。第二种是使用myodbc驱动程序。

(本文来源于图老师网站,更多请访问http://m.tulaoshi.com/bianchengyuyan/)

  你可以到www.mysql.com下载myodbc驱动程序,然后照着下面的做就可以了

  第一种选择是下载完全安装包,这种包很大,但对于我们来说有用的只有myodbc.dll这个文件,却要下载这么大的文件,不太合适。当然,如果你很菜的话,我建议你选择这种方式,这样容易些,但不符合cfans的作风,是吧。

(本文来源于图老师网站,更多请访问http://m.tulaoshi.com/bianchengyuyan/)

  第二种是直接下载myodbc.dll文件,只有几百k,但不太容易使用,本人经过很久摸索才找到使用它的方法。 首先你将包解开,将myodbc.dll 文件放到windowssystem 或 winntsystem32目录下,这取决于你的系统是win9x还是winnt(win2k),你应该知道吧。然后打开一纯文本编辑器,如editplus,notpad之类,(取决于你的喜好)将下面一段话保存为一文件,扩展名为.reg,知道了吧,这是注册表文件,不要搞错呀(不包括下面的一长串等号)如果你用的是win2k请将第一行换成

Windows Registry Editor Version 5.00
==========================================================从下行开始
Windows Registry Editor Version 4.00

[HKEY_LOCAL_MACHINESOFTWAREODBCODBCINST.INImyodbc driver]
"UsageCount"=dword:00000002
"Driver"="C:WINNTSystem32myodbc.dll"
"Setup"="C:WINNTSystem32myodbc.dll"
"SQLLevel"="1"
"FileUsage"="0"
"DriverODBCVer"="02.50"
"ConnectFunctions"="YYY"
"APILevel"="1"
"CpTimeout"="120"
[HKEY_LOCAL_MACHINESOFTWAREODBCODBCINST.INIODBC Drivers]
"myodbc driver"="installed"

=======================================结束于上一行
  至于为什么要写这些,你就不要问我了,我也不想回答,这是收费门先生说了算的(bill.gates)就这样吧.保存后,双击刚才的文件,应该叫 xxx.reg 吧,然后选择确定,ok,搞定了。然后你打开odbc设置程序,建一新数据源,选择myodbc驱动程序,剩下的就看你自己了。==============================================================

展开更多 50%)
分享

猜你喜欢

怎么样在vc、delphi里面运用mysql(mysql odbc驱动地运用)

编程语言 网络编程
怎么样在vc、delphi里面运用mysql(mysql odbc驱动地运用)

怎样在vc、delphi中使用mysql(mysql odbc驱动的使用)

MySQL mysql数据库
怎样在vc、delphi中使用mysql(mysql odbc驱动的使用)

s8lol主宰符文怎么配

英雄联盟 网络游戏
s8lol主宰符文怎么配

怎样在vc、delphi中使用mysql

编程语言 网络编程
怎样在vc、delphi中使用mysql

运用MySql ODBC进行MYsql和MS sql7地数据转换

编程语言 网络编程
运用MySql ODBC进行MYsql和MS sql7地数据转换

lol偷钱流符文搭配推荐

英雄联盟 网络游戏
lol偷钱流符文搭配推荐

怎么样完成MySQL里面地用户管理?

编程语言 网络编程
怎么样完成MySQL里面地用户管理?

怎么样把ACCESS地数据导入到Mysql里面

编程语言 网络编程
怎么样把ACCESS地数据导入到Mysql里面

lolAD刺客新符文搭配推荐

英雄联盟
lolAD刺客新符文搭配推荐

Win10 Build 10147 Spartan浏览器正式启用Edge标签

Win10 Build 10147 Spartan浏览器正式启用Edge标签

一段貌似简单的JavaScript

一段貌似简单的JavaScript
下拉加载更多内容 ↓